Ashanti D. Braxton, DDS, is a tenured associate professor in the Department of General Dentistry at the University of Tennessee Health Science Center College of Dentistry in Memphis. She has been in dental academia for the past 9 years and truly enjoys educating dental students about providing preventive and comprehensive dental care to all populations. Braxton is also a member of the American Dental Association, Tennessee Dental Association, and Memphis Dental Society.
